Optimization and Evaluation of a Fluorescence Oil Spill Detector. Volume 2. Prototype Design.

Abstract

This report reviews the operational and technical requirements of a low cost harbor surveillance unit and describes the design of a Scanning Oil Spill Detector. Operational considerations such as coverage resulted in a design containing both azimuth and elevation scanning. The incremental cost of scanning is less than the cost of additional units needed to provide the additional coverage.
